I have seen it before and it had the same mistake. don't get me wrong your car is great and I think your doing a good job but I just think the design of your intake manifold is wrong. I will do you a diagram later, heres what I was planning for my 4af head:

 

drawingintake01.jpg

 

 

if the throttles are just adapted to go directly to the head then there will be massive eddies in the air path as the air flows over a sharp edge. My aeronautical friends tell me the maximum change in angle in any intake before stuffing up the laminar flow is 7 degrees. There needs to be a radius from the intake ports angle to the horizontal angle of the throttles.
